titleOfInvention PROTECTION AGAINST THE FADING OF COLORS DERIVED FROM NATURAL SOURCES USED IN BEVERAGE PRODUCTS.
abstract A beverage product is described which includes water, a color derived from natural sources or its synthetic equivalent, and a color fading inhibitor that includes a compound selected from the group consisting of enzymatically modified isoquercitin (EMIQ), rutin and myrithyrin, and optionally fumaric acid. The incorporation of EMIQ may be particularly useful for inhibiting color fading of the beverage product exposed to UV light radiation. The colors derived from natural sources can be beta-carotene, black carrot and / or natural apple extract. EMIQ can effectively prevent color fading even in the presence of ascorbic acid, which promotes fading of colors derived from natural sources. In addition, a method is provided to inhibit the fading of colors derived from sources in a beverage composition.
